Bug#248366: g++-3.3 1:3.3.3-7 starts to give ICE's on both i386 and powerpc



Package: g++-3.3
Version: 1:3.3.3-7
Severity: serious
Justification: Causes other packages to FTBFS

With 1:3.3.3-6 (no bug) or -7 (bug):

# apt-get build-dep povray-3.5
$ apt-get source povray-3.5
$ cd povray-3.5-3.5.0c/src
$ i386-linux-g++  -DPREFIX=\"/usr\" \
	-DPOV_LIB_DIR=\"/usr/share/povray-3.5\"  \
	-DCOMPILER_VER=\".Linux.i386-linux-gcc\" \
	-DSYSCONFDIR=\"/etc/povray-3.5\"         -DUSE_IO_RESTRICTIONS=\"\" -I. \
	-I. -I.  -W -O3 -finline-functions -ffast-math \
	-fomit-frame-pointer -fexpensive-optimizations \
	-foptimize-sibling-calls -minline-all-stringops -funroll-loops \
	-Wno-multichar -MT bezier.o         -MD -MP -MF ".deps/bezier.Tpo" -c -o \
	bezier.o bezier.cpp

If -6, if succeeds, if -7, it fails with this output:

| bezier.cpp: In function `void bezier_bounding_sphere(double
| (*)[4][4][3],
|    double*, double*)':
|    bezier.cpp:859: internal compiler error: Segmentation fault
| Please submit a full bug report,
| with preprocessed source if appropriate.
| See <URL:http://gcc.gnu.org/bugs.html> for instructions.

Note that I couldn't get -save-temps to trigger the same error.
